Best P. kerrasis for juicing with good eating and processing qualities. Dark red-black fruit ripens in late summer and early fall. Self-pollinating. Tree form.
All of these cherries are bigger, redder and sweeter than Michigan pie cherries. These hybrids are 75% P. cerasus and 25% P. fruiticosa and are named P. x kerrasis to honor the work of Dr. Kerr. The fruit easily approaches a Brix rating of 16 to 22%, but still contains the citric acid than makes them �tart� or �sour� cherries. Typical �Montmorency� pie cherries fall into the range of 11 to 16 degrees Brix.
